Crafting Compelling Teasers: A Guide To Writing Effective M&A Introductions

The importance of a teaser in the complex world of mergers & acquisitions (M&A) cannot be understated. Serving as the initial introduction to potential buyers teasers are the first step to presenting your business with a style that will entice curiosity without giving too much.

Making a teaser that works requires a well-thought out strategy that manages to strike a balance between excitement with the need for security. This step-by-step process will help you.

1. Consider your audience before you record your teaser, take a look at the thoughts of your potential customers. What kind of information could pique their interest without revealing too excessively? Create a teaser that resonates with the group you’re trying to reach.

2. Clarity in the Purpose: Simply define the purpose of your teaser. Are you emphasizing key financial metrics, showcasing growth potential or using unique selling points? The clarity of your goal can guide the content creation process.

3. Teasers should be short and concise. The content should be restricted to just one or two slides. Each slide should make an impactful effect and contribute to the overall excitement.

4. Create Visual Appeal: Use images that compliment the text. Charts, graphs as well as images can add to the visual impact of your teaser, making it more appealing to potential buyers.

5. Keep Confidentiality. While you should give enough information to generate an interest, avoid disclosing sensitive details which could compromise the privacy of your company. Teasers should keep your company’s identity secret until you receive a genuine buyer interest.

Understand the impact of teasers on M&A

Teasers give an “first glance” of your company to potential buyers who are interested in an M&A. These are the primary takeaways from teasers which make them valuable in this scenario.

Strategic Introduction: Teasers are a great way to provide a strategic introduction to your business providing essential information that attracts attention while maintaining confidentiality. These teasers serve to stimulate curiosity and open the door to more discussion.

Confidentiality Shield – The discrete nature of teasers protects the privacy of your company. In revealing just enough details to attract potential customers without revealing your identity teasers provide a secure area for first-time interactions.

Teasers are utilized as an assessment tool for potential buyers. Teasers give a comprehensive overview that lets buyers know the likelihood of acquiring your company with their strategic objectives and financial criteria.

Snapshot of Value: Teasers provide prospective buyers with a quick overview of the value your company can bring to the table. This short overview will aid buyers in determining the potential return on their investment and decide whether they want to proceed with further discussions.

Prepare for In-Depth Discussions An appropriately designed teaser can set the stage for more in-depth discussions in the subsequent phases of the M&A process. It is a great conversation starter that will allow potential buyers to express their interest and demand more details.
